Introduction
Your browser is a client requesting resources from servers worldwide over interconnected networks.
Why This Topic Matters
“Cannot reach server” tickets need basic mental model — not magic. Devs and QA debug network layers daily.
Real-Life Example
Browser → DNS finds IP → TCP connection → HTTPS request → server responds with HTML/JSON.
Syntax Breakdown
Client/server, packet, router, ISP, data center. Requests travel across many hops.
